20000210999 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 20000211000. Its totient is φ = 20000210998.
The previous prime is 20000210987. The next prime is 20000211001. The reversal of 20000210999 is 99901200002.
It is a strong pr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is a de Polignac number, because none of the positive numbers 2k-20000210999 is a prime.
It is a Sophie Germain prime.
Together with 20000211001, it forms a pair of twin primes.
It is a Chen prime.
It is a congruent number.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(20000218999) by changing a digit.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(13)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 10000105499 + 10000105500.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(10000105500).
Almost surely, 220000210999 is an apocalyptic number.
20000210999 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
20000210999 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
20000210999 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 2916, while the sum is 32.
